Does it have to be new and current gear? If not, there are other options to consider. I found my analog peace of mind with a vintage Micro RX-1500G table + CU-180 copper mat with Fidelity Research FR-64s tonearm and FR-7fz MC cartridge, total market value around €8000.
This set up has ended my search for a 'final' turntable, after going through a whole sequence of 'modern' tables, none of which truly convinced me. These included Clearaudio Master Solution with magnetic bearing and Synchro power unit, SME 10 and TW Acustic Raven GT SE with Black Night feet & motor controller.
It took a leap of faith as well as some courage (for me at least) going down the vintage road, but I haven't regretted it for one moment. It's hard to believe that 35+ year gear can compete with similar or higher priced 'high end' current designs. But every time I sit down and listen there's just no denying.
You said all insights and options are welcome, so perhaps this is something to consider?
